Our Programs
Aldea offers a wide variety of treatment options with a continuum of care ranging
from outpatient services, therapeutic schools, supported living to developmentally
disabled adults, treatment foster care, and residential treatment. Throughout the
continuum of care we provide advocacy, child abuse prevention and treatment, counseling
and consultation, individual, group and family psychotherapy, psychiatric evaluation
and medication management, psychological assessment, school based therapeutic services,
teen mentoring, and respite.
Aldea’s Mental Health Programs
Outpatient
Counseling Centers in Napa and Sonoma County. Our board-certified child psychiatrist
and therapists make Aldea a beacon of hope in the heart of our community. We care
for children and their families at our Napa and Solano clinics, in schools, and
through targeted community initiatives, like our art therapy program for kids.
ADAPT. This day treatment program
helps emotionally disturbed teenagers who have not been able to function successfully
in public school and are in danger of being placed in group homes. A high school
curriculum is supplemented by individual, group and family therapy, plus round-the-clock
on-call support aimed at keeping families together.
Solano Parent Network.
We meet the deep needs of parents of emotionally disturbed children with information,
education, support groups and sometimes just a break from the demands of parenting.
Supported Living
Services. Adults with developmental disabilities are able to live independent
lives when given crucial support. SLS clients live on their own in the community,
receiving help with grocery shopping, housekeeping, transportation, mental and medical
needs, and much more.
Aldea’s Child Welfare Programs
Treatment Foster Care.
We take in kids in crisis who have been removed from their homes because of abuse
or serious neglect, and we keep them safe. Our foster families are extensively screened
and trained to build trust with kids who have had too little in their lives. We
work to reunite children with birth parents, or to find “forever families” who are
ready to adopt through the Aldea adoption program.
Redwood Treatment Center and Aldea School. Teenage boys who can’t live at
home because of severe emotional and behavioral difficulties get 24-hour care in
a safe, therapeutic family setting. A highly structured environment includes a full
curriculum, behavior management and mental healthcare.
